Detectives investigating a firearms incident and subsequent linked offences in the area of Cemetery Road, in Dewsbury, on the 1st February arrested four men yesterday
The four men aged 31, 30, 19 and 18 have been arrested on suspicion of attempted murder, robbery, attempted robbery and threats to damage. They remain in police custody at this time.
A 24-year-old man who was injured in the incident remains in hospital.
Police are continuing to appeal for information from the local community about the circumstances of the incident. Anyone with any information is asked to contact police on 101.
